using UnityEngine;
using OctoberStudio.VAT;
namespace OctoberStudio
{
/// <summary>
/// 把 VAT prefab 挂到原 EnemyBehavior 上,作为视觉替换层。
/// - 隐藏原 SpriteRenderer / Animator(留 Shadow)
/// - Spawn VAT view 作为子物体
/// - 朝向: 把 EnemyBehavior.ExternalFacingOverride 设 true,EnemyBehavior 不再写 transform.localScale.x,
/// sign 通过 OnFacingSignChanged event 推给本组件 → 调 VATAnimationController.SetFacing。
/// 一律走 Y 旋转,完全不依赖 localScale。
/// </summary>
[DisallowMultipleComponent]
public class EnemyVATAttachment : MonoBehaviour
{
[Header("VAT Source")]
[Tooltip("烤好的 VAT prefab (e.g. mon1001_VAT.prefab)")]
[SerializeField] private GameObject vatPrefab;
[Header("View Transform")]
[SerializeField] private Vector3 localOffset = new Vector3(0f, 0.3f, 0f);
[SerializeField] private Vector3 localScale = new Vector3(0.5f, 0.5f, 0.5f);
[Header("Hide Originals")]
[Tooltip("不禁用名字含此关键字的 SpriteRenderer (默认 Shadow 阴影保留)")]
[SerializeField] private string keepNameContains = "Shadow";
private GameObject _spawnedView;
private VATAnimationController _vatCtrl;
private EnemyBehavior _enemy;
private void Awake()
{
_enemy = GetComponent<EnemyBehavior>();
HideOriginalSprites();
SpawnVATView();
if (_spawnedView != null)
{
_vatCtrl = _spawnedView.GetComponent<VATAnimationController>();
}
// 接管 EnemyBehavior 朝向:不再写 transform.localScale.x,sign 走 event
if (_enemy != null)
{
_enemy.ExternalFacingOverride = true;
_enemy.OnFacingSignChanged += HandleEnemyFacingChanged;
}
// 出生时同步一次初始朝向(VATAnimationController.OnEnable 默认 SetFacing(+1) 已先跑过,
// 这里覆盖一次以应对对象池复用或 prefab 上 root.scale.x 非常规情况)
if (_vatCtrl != null) _vatCtrl.SetFacing(1);
}
private void OnDestroy()
{
if (_enemy != null) _enemy.OnFacingSignChanged -= HandleEnemyFacingChanged;
}
private void HandleEnemyFacingChanged(int sign)
{
if (_vatCtrl != null) _vatCtrl.SetFacing(sign);
}
private void HideOriginalSprites()
{
var all = GetComponentsInChildren<SpriteRenderer>(true);
foreach (var sr in all)
{
if (!string.IsNullOrEmpty(keepNameContains) &&
sr.gameObject.name.IndexOf(keepNameContains, System.StringComparison.OrdinalIgnoreCase) >= 0)
continue;
sr.enabled = false;
}
// 子物体上的 Animator 也禁用(主 Sprite 那个,Animator 切 Sprite 已无用,省 CPU)
var animators = GetComponentsInChildren<Animator>(true);
foreach (var an in animators)
{
if (!string.IsNullOrEmpty(keepNameContains) &&
an.gameObject.name.IndexOf(keepNameContains, System.StringComparison.OrdinalIgnoreCase) >= 0)
continue;
an.enabled = false;
}
}
private void SpawnVATView()
{
if (vatPrefab == null) return;
_spawnedView = Instantiate(vatPrefab, transform);
_spawnedView.name = "_VAT_View";
_spawnedView.transform.localPosition = localOffset;
_spawnedView.transform.localScale = localScale;
// 注意: 不在这里写 localRotation = identity!
// VATAnimationController.OnEnable 已在 Instantiate 中调过 SetFacing(),把 Y 设成了 ±facing 值,
// 这里 reset 会把它抹成 0,导致 LateUpdate 第一次跑之前 view 朝向是错的。
// VAT prefab 的 root rotation 本身就是 identity,无需重置。
}
#if UNITY_EDITOR
// 仅给 Editor 工具读
public GameObject VATPrefab
{
get => vatPrefab;
set => vatPrefab = value;
}
public Vector3 LocalScale
{
get => localScale;
set => localScale = value;
}
public Vector3 LocalOffset
{
get => localOffset;
set => localOffset = value;
}
#endif
}
}
